Practical Designer Notes: Test, Compare, and Confirm
Before finalizing any design, test Digital Corporate Icons with your brand color palette. Check how it looks in black and white and ensure it works well in different contexts. Place it inside real campaign mockups to see how it interacts with other elements.
Preview it on mobile screens to confirm readability in small sizes. Compare it against competitor visuals to ensure it stands out while still fitting within industry standards. Check how it pairs with various font styles—serif, sans serif, script, handwritten, and display fonts—to find the best match for your brand.
Review spacing and balance to avoid overloading the design. Most importantly, confirm the commercial license before using it in paid campaigns, client work, or business branding. This ensures you have the rights to use the asset without legal issues.
